PAD and PAH response patterns of group Ia- and Ib-fibers to cutaneous and descending inputs in the cat spinal cord.

Abstract

The characteristics of the primary afferent depolarization (PAD) of Ia- and Ib-fibers generated by segmental and descending inputs have been analyzed in the spinal cord of anesthetized cats. The PAD was inferred from the changes produced by conditioning inputs on the intraspinal stimulus current required to produce a constant antidromic firing of single group I afferent fibers from the gastrocnemius (GS) or posterior biceps and semitendinosus (PBSt) nerves. Group I GS and PBSt fibers ending in the intermediate nucleus could be classified in three different types according to their PAD patterns in response to stimulation of cutaneous nerves and of descending fibers. In one set of group I fibers stimulation of cutaneous nerves and of the ipsilateral brain stem reticular formation, or the contralateral red nucleus, produced no PAD, but was able to inhibit the PAD generated by stimulation of group I fibers from flexors (type A PAD pattern). PBSt nerve fibers with this PAD pattern had peripheral thresholds and conduction velocities between 1.01 and 1.56 times threshold and 76.3 to 118 m/s, respectively. A second set of group I fibers was found to be depolarized by cutaneous nerves as well as by stimulation of rubrospinal and reticulospinal fibers (type B PAD pattern). The peripheral thresholds and conduction velocities of PBSt afferent fibers with a type B PAD pattern were of 1.66-2.03 times threshold and 71-83 m/s, respectively. We found a third set of group I fibers that were also depolarized by reticulospinal and rubrospinal inputs, but not by cutaneous nerves that instead inhibited the PAD elicited by group I volleys in flexor nerves (type C PAD pattern). All PBSt afferent fibers with a type C PAD pattern, with the exception of two, had peripheral thresholds and velocities between 1.46 and 2.16 times threshold and between 72 and 89 m/s, respectively. Stimulation of the Deiter's nucleus was found to depolarize the intraspinal terminals of a small fraction of group I GS fibers with a type A PAD pattern and of all group I GS and PBSt fibers with type B and C PAD patterns. The PAD produced by vestibulospinal stimulation in fibers with type A and C PAD patterns could be inhibited by conditioning volleys applied to cutaneous nerves. It is suggested that group I afferent fibers from flexors and extensors with a type A PAD pattern are group Ia, and that most fibers with type B and type C PAD patterns are group Ib.(ABSTRACT TRUNCATED AT 400 WORDS)

摘要

在麻醉猫的脊髓中,已对由节段性和下行性输入产生的Ia和Ib纤维的初级传入去极化(PAD)特征进行了分析。PAD是根据条件性输入对产生腓肠肌(GS)或肱二头肌和半腱肌(PBSt)神经单组I类传入纤维恒定逆向发放所需的脊髓内刺激电流产生的变化来推断的。根据其对皮肤神经和下行纤维刺激的PAD模式,终止于中间核的I类GS和PBSt纤维可分为三种不同类型。在一组I类纤维中,刺激皮肤神经、同侧脑干网状结构或对侧红核不会产生PAD,但能够抑制由屈肌I类纤维刺激产生的PAD(A型PAD模式)。具有这种PAD模式的PBSt神经纤维的外周阈值和传导速度分别在阈值的1.01至1.56倍和76.3至118 m/s之间。发现第二组I类纤维被皮肤神经以及红核脊髓和网状脊髓纤维的刺激去极化(B型PAD模式)。具有B型PAD模式的PBSt传入纤维的外周阈值和传导速度分别为阈值的1.66 - 2.03倍和71 - 83 m/s。我们发现第三组I类纤维也被网状脊髓和红核脊髓输入去极化,但未被皮肤神经去极化,皮肤神经反而抑制了屈肌神经中I类冲动引发的PAD(C型PAD模式)。除两条外,所有具有C型PAD模式的PBSt传入纤维的外周阈值和速度分别在阈值的1.46至2.16倍和72至89 m/s之间。发现刺激Deiter核会使一小部分具有A型PAD模式的I类GS纤维以及所有具有B型和C型PAD模式的I类GS和PBSt纤维的脊髓内终末去极化。前庭脊髓刺激在具有A型和C型PAD模式的纤维中产生的PAD可被施加于皮肤神经的条件性冲动所抑制。提示具有A型PAD模式的来自屈肌和伸肌的I类传入纤维为Ia类,而大多数具有B型和C型PAD模式的纤维为Ib类。(摘要截取自400字)
